Lemon Jelly

Nice Weather for Ducks

Label: Release Date: 03/01/2003

swijetilleka by Sajini Wijetilleka January 4th, 2003

I can't think of anybody who would want to buy this.......

A gentleman not dissimilar to the irrepressible Uncle Adolph from the Sound of Music bellows the listener into the surreal realm of Lemon Jelly.

The sleigh bells and glockenspiel of Austria are a wisely abandoned focus, giving way to some mid-tempo beats, a string quartet and acoustic guitar reminiscent of a travel programme theme tune I cannot rightly place. Uncle Adolph bounces back at regular intervals, a funky crescendo takes place, and with a competent brass band employed to bring in a grand finale, I can see the Avalanches comparison, but am perplexed as to what the fuss is about on the strength of this inimitable but seemingly pointless tune, which is, as a single, neither danceable or listenable. Definite album filler.
